Pinxo by Ferran Lajara
Spanish designer Ferran Lajara has designed Pinxo, a wooden clothes peg with a hook on one side.

The title of the project is a combination of the Catalan words Pinça and ganxo.

The product is produced by Barcelona-based DIY brand Servei Estació.

Here's some information about the designer:

Born in Barcelona in 1983. Ferran Lajara studied a BA Product Design at Eina, Escola de disseny i art, Barcelona, graduating in 2006.

After that, he moved to London, where he studied Furniture Design at Central Saint Martins College of Art and Design and a MA Product Design at Kingston University.

Ferran Lajara has collaborated with different studios in Barcelona (lagranja, design for companies and friends) and London (AB rogers design).
